Hello,

As flagged for security review: the Findlet autocomplete index was serving p99 lookups above 800ms after last week's vocabulary expansion. We rebuilt the prefix trie with compressed nodes and moved cold shards to the secondary tier, bringing p99 under 90ms. No query logging, retention, or access-control behavior changed; the diff is confined to the index builder and shard placement logic. Full benchmark artifacts are attached to the release record. The reviewed artifact corresponds to the build token below.

pipeline stamp: htk9_ce63042d9

Kiosk Watchdog — Build Provenance. The Pellamy kiosk watchdog is built nightly from the hardened branch only. No local builds go to devices, ever. Each image is signed by the Orvik pipeline and logged in the provenance ledger; contractors verify against that ledger before flashing. If a unit reboots unexpectedly, pull its manifest first. The currently blessed watchdog image corresponds to the token below.

session token of kageg-tahop = htk14_af3c1ccccb7dcf

Subject: Key rotation for Driftpane diff API

Plugin authors,

We are rotating credentials for Driftpane, the large-file diff viewer backend. Old keys stop working at the end of the week. Chunked diff requests, hunk streaming, and the preview endpoint are all affected; nothing else changes. Update your plugin configuration before the cutoff or requests will return authorization errors. Test against staging first if you can. Your replacement key follows.

gateway credential: kto23_LX9A4ys6i4nzHtpOLNLodKK